3. Liability and Insurance

Never assume a contractor is insured. If a technician is injured on your property or your garage header is damaged during installation, you could be liable without proper coverage.

  • The Pro Move: Ask to see a current liability insurance certificate and WSIB clearance. A professional company will provide these without hesitation.

3. Understand the “Hidden” Costs

If a quote seems too good to be true, it probably is. Does the price include the removal and disposal of your old door? Does it include heavy-duty hardware or standard-grade? Always ask for an itemized breakdown to ensure you’re getting a fair market price.

4. Check the Warranty (Beyond the Manufacturer)

Most manufacturers offer a 2-year warranty on parts, but what about the labor? A quality installer should stand behind their craftsmanship. Ask what happens if the door becomes misaligned six months after the install.

5. Spot the “Fake Review” Trap

When checking Google or Yelp, look for specifics. Be wary of accounts that leave glowing 5-star reviews without mentioning the specific service provided. Real customers usually mention the technician’s name or the specific style of door they purchased.
